One of my favourite all time and go to rigs.... Trident tackle is spot on for this.... Only thing I do different is I replace crimps with a little bit of silicone tube as this doesn't damage the line and allows fine adjustment too
Nice one Steve you can't beat tridents gear it's top notch, the way I make this rig in the video allows less crimps to be used being the only one under the hangover power gum is also a good alternative to replace the crimp but I will deffo try with the tubing as suggested what size tubing do you use and brand please
I use gemini rig tubing... I normally cut it into about 3 mm sections and put 2 of those on.... Any bigger then it makes it harder to move and adjust... Using 2 smaller pieces allows movement while still locking into place.... The other thing I do is put a small bead under the spring to stop it from sliding over the tube (or crimp which I have tried too)

Nice video Jason, and a rig I'll give a try. I was trying to figure out the benefit of the spring, but I can see it may reduce the shock loading on the hook length when casting and ensure the main body length takes the strain. I notice your braid scissors were struggling a bit with the thicker line, I've switched to using sidecutters for rig making and haven't looked back - because they pinch rather than shear they never roll over the line.
Hi George the spring is used to keep the tention on line while in the clip
Once it hits the water it ejects forcefully to push the line away from the lead
Deffo need new cutters lol
With the running lead it's an up and over pulley rig so the tension comes for free. The lead will always slide to balance the rig for the cast providing the hook length is less than twice the length of the running length. Using a bait clip at the top of the rig reduces the parts count by 3 or 4 components. I don't think Trident have a suitable component, it would look something like the offspring of a Termalink and a Hangover.
